Island of Wings by Karin Altenberg

Neil and Lizzie MacKenzie set off to lonely St Kilda off the cost of Scotland, one searching for redemption, the other for purpose.

Putting their marriage and sanity to the test, the newlywed MacKenzies sail in 1830 to the isolated yet hauntingly beautiful St Kilda islands on Scotland's outermost Hebrides. Neil's evangelical mission is clear: Challenge the native's pagan ways and find atonement for his own past sins, while his devoted wife, Lizzie, searches for a sense of purpose and belonging in a new world neither truly understands.
